Output b59f0512eef8de399d8e83e7d8a03e0f840af6bb227ee8ef5d6b161c6ebacdb8:0

value
1446252903
script pubkey
OP_0 OP_PUSHBYTES_20 74b16673f090693286ec925a0178ab7ef4ab1170
address
bc1qwjckvulsjp5n9phvjfdqz79t0m62kytsvshcy3
transaction
b59f0512eef8de399d8e83e7d8a03e0f840af6bb227ee8ef5d6b161c6ebacdb8
confirmations
322265
spent
true